MiuH Sylvia Kelley of Torrliigton wim shot and kilhd at Henry. Neb, nine miles east of Torrlngton, by C. L Landry, a detective of Denver. Sheriff Janies Sherman and Landry were searching for a stolen automobile. Miss Kelley was in a ear with James Nolan, a garage man of Torrlngton, when the officers attempted to search the car. Nolan started to floe. Both officers fired and Miss Kelley dropped dead from the shot fired by Landry, according to the story told by the of fleers.
